    I am not a big fan of this place. Parallel is located inside the Marriott. It has a nice interior and a pleasant atmosphere. However the place is impossible to find. Seriously. I got lost when attempting to find it even with my GPS. The turn into the hotel comes up really suddenly so be on the lookout for that. They, or the hotel in general, really need a better sign or something. When I did find my way inside, I then could not find the restaurant and some ladies pointed me toward it. Not a friendly vibe in the air. I wasn't feeling to hot and just had a grilled cheese sandwich. The menu was extremely limited anyway so I figured how can I go wrong with a grilled cheese.But I didn't care for it. The bread had sort of a bland taste. I do not think it was white bread. I did not finish it.The food also took a long time and the place itself didn't feel comfy or welcoming. There was this odd stiff quality to everything even the tables. And given how limited the menu was, I did not feel the urgent need to come back. As for the positive, it's pretty inside and seems clean. The staff themselves were quite pleasant. It ultimately was just an OK experience for me.

    Very enjoyable lunch. The menu was short and sweet. I asked if I could just have a simple grill cheese sandwich on sourdough bread. The waiter said no problem. I decided to try the sea salt fries with it. My daughter chimed in that she would have them same thing. In no time our sandwiches were delivered exactly as we ordered. The fries were heavenly. The price was heavenly too. If I ever get back to this hotel I will be sure I go to the Parallel!
